Coding Helps Children Build Logical Thinking Skills
Coding teaches kids how to think in a structured and organized way.
Every coding project follows a sequence of instructions. If one step is incorrect or missing, the program may not work as expected. Through this process, children naturally learn how to think step by step and understand how actions affect outcomes.
As students learn coding, they develop skills such as:
- Sequential thinking
- Cause-and-effect understanding
- Attention to detail
- Logical reasoning
- Structured problem-solving
These abilities often help children become more confident learners in school and better problem-solvers in everyday situations.
Coding Makes Math More Interactive
Many students struggle with math because concepts can feel abstract when only taught through textbooks and worksheets.
Coding changes that by helping kids apply math concepts through real projects and creative activities.
As children build games, animations, and coding challenges, they naturally begin using:
- Patterns and sequences
- Variables and equations
- Coordinates and positioning
- Timing and measurements
- Logic-based calculations
Instead of memorizing formulas, students see how math works in practical situations.
This hands-on learning approach can make math more engaging and easier to understand for many children.

Coding Teaches Kids How to Solve Problems
One of the most valuable skills coding teaches is how to approach complex problems with confidence.
Large challenges can feel overwhelming for children, but coding encourages students to break problems into smaller, manageable steps.
During coding lessons, students learn how to:
- Identify the problem
- Break it into smaller tasks
- Solve each step individually
- Test their solutions
- Improve and complete the project
This process, often called computational thinking, helps students become more organized, analytical, and confident in their abilities.
These skills are valuable not only in coding but across math, science, and many other school subjects.
Coding Builds Persistence and Resilience
Coding also teaches children that mistakes are a normal part of learning.
Programs do not always work correctly the first time, and students quickly learn how to troubleshoot errors, test solutions, and keep improving their projects.
Through this process, children develop:
- Patience
- Persistence
- Critical thinking
- Adaptability
- Confidence in problem-solving
Instead of giving up when something feels difficult, students learn how to stay focused and continue working toward a solution.
